SETTING THE BACKREST HEIGHT AND ANGLE
The backrest height and angle are
adjusted at the same time using just one
tool from the back of the backrest.
The backrest height can be adjusted to
reach your lower back precisely where it
needs the most support. The angle should
be adjusted along with the saddle for an
upright or a more laid-back position.

A. Backrest carrier clamp bolt
B. Backrest
1. Loosen the backrest carrier clamp (A) using
an Allen key until the backrest (B) can
move freely
2. Move the backrest to the desired height
and angle
3. Tighten the backrest in the new position
using the Allen key
